vlookup函数的使用方法有哪些步骤?
VLOOKUP函数的规范使用需严格遵循“定位查找值—划定左对齐数据表—指定列序数—设定匹配类型”四步逻辑。它并非简单套用公式,而是以数据结构为前提:查找值必须位于数据表首列,区域需用绝对引用锁定(如$B$2:$F$9),列序数从左向右计数且不可越界,匹配类型优先选用0实现精确检索;在此基础上,单条件查询可秒级提取工资或部门,多列返回支持{2,3,5}数组写法,IFERROR函数能优雅处理缺失值,而结合COLUMN或IF({1,0})等组合技巧,更可拓展出横向拉取、反向检索与多条件联查等实用场景——每一步操作都对应着Excel数据治理的底层逻辑。
一、基础操作四步法必须闭环执行
首先在目标单元格输入“=VLOOKUP(”,接着依次填入四个参数:查找值(如员工姓名所在单元格B3)、查找区域(务必用绝对引用锁定,例如$B$2:$F$9,避免下拉时区域偏移)、返回列号(从区域左起第一列为1开始计数,若要提取部门则看其在$B$2:$F$9中是第几列,如C列为第2列)、匹配类型(日常业务必须填0或FALSE,确保精确匹配)。全部输入完毕后按回车确认,再选中该单元格向下拖拽填充,即可批量完成整列查询。此流程不可跳步,尤其需规避“整列引用”(如B:F)导致计算变慢及错误扩散。
二、多列同步提取需用数组常量写法
当需一次性获取同一员工的部门、岗位与基本工资三项信息时,不能重复书写三次公式,而应在首个目标单元格中输入=VLOOKUP(H3,$B$2:$F$9,{2,3,5},0),其中{2,3,5}为数组常量,表示分别返回查找区域中第2、第3、第5列的数据。输入后必须按Ctrl+Shift+Enter(旧版Excel)或直接回车(Microsoft 365/WPS最新版),Excel将自动以大括号包裹公式并横向输出三列结果。该方法大幅减少公式冗余,提升表格可维护性。
三、反向与横向查找依赖函数嵌套逻辑
反向查找(如根据姓名查工号,而工号在姓名左侧)需借助IF({1,0},原列,目标列)构建新二维数组,公式为=VLOOKUP(H3,IF({1,0},B:B,A:A),2,0),强制将工号列置于新数组首列。横向多列拉取则利用COLUMN(B1)生成动态列号,公式为=VLOOKUP($I3,$B:$F,COLUMN(B1),0),向右拖拽时COLUMN函数自动变为COLUMN(C1)=3、COLUMN(D1)=4,从而逐列提取性别、年龄、工资等字段,无需手动修改列序数。
四、容错与实战适配需前置设计
所有正式报表中,VLOOKUP必须嵌套IFERROR函数,如=IFERROR(VLOOKUP(H3,$B$2:$F$9,2,0),“未找到”),避免#N/A干扰数据可视化。同时严禁在查找区域中混用合并单元格,若遇此结构,须先取消合并并填充数据,否则将导致漏查。多条件查找应统一用连接符&构造复合键,如H3&I3对应部门+姓名组合,并配合IF({1,0})重排区域,确保逻辑严密。
掌握这些结构化操作,就能让VLOOKUP真正成为数据处理的稳定引擎。
优惠推荐

- 唯卓仕85mm F1.8 Z/X/FE卡口微单相机中远摄人像定焦自动对焦镜头
优惠前¥2229
¥1729优惠后

- Sony/索尼 Alpha 7R V A7RM5新一代全画幅微单双影像画质旗舰相机
优惠前¥27998
¥22499优惠后


